Stock Photo - Old olive trees with big roots in the ancient farming land of Maremma, near Albarese, Tuscany, Italy.

Stock Photo: Old olive trees with big roots in the ancient farming land of Maremma, near Albarese, Tuscany, Italy.

Searchable keywords

Choose multiple keywords